The Perfect Brownie-Cookie Hybrid
Salted Brownie Cookies stand out because of their unique texture. Unlike traditional cookie dough, this batter feels thinner and more like brownie batter. That texture creates the signature shiny tops and crackly finish.
Beating the eggs and sugar until frothy helps build structure. Meanwhile, melting chocolate with butter forms the rich base. When you combine everything quickly and bake immediately, you lock in that glossy, crinkled surface.
Additionally, the short bake time keeps the centers soft and fudgy. Therefore, you get chewy edges and tender middles in every bite.
Sweet Meets Salty Balance
Chocolate alone tastes amazing. However, adding sea salt flakes elevates it even more. The salt enhances sweetness while highlighting the deep cocoa flavor.
Because Salted Brownie Cookies contain both melted chocolate and cocoa powder, they deliver layered richness. Espresso powder, although optional, intensifies that flavor without making the cookies taste like coffee.
As a result, every ingredient works together to create bold, balanced chocolate goodness.
Ingredients for the Best Salted Brownie Cookies
Dry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/8 teaspoon salt
Keep the flour measurement accurate. Too much flour leads to cakier cookies instead of fudgy ones.
Wet Ingredients
- 2 large eggs, room temperature
- 1 large egg yolk, room temperature
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Room temperature eggs blend more smoothly. Therefore, take them out about 30 minutes before baking.
Chocolate Base
- 6 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ips (plus extra for topping)
- 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1 teaspoon espresso powder (optional)
Melting butter and chocolate together creates the smooth foundation for Salted Brownie Cookies.
Topping
- Sea salt flakes (optional but recommended)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prep Before Mixing
First, preheat your oven to 350°F. Then, line two ba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one mats. Measure all ingredients before starting. Because this batter works best when baked immediately, preparation makes a big difference.
Step 2: Mix the Dry Ingredients
In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.
Step 3: Beat the Wet Ingredients
Using a stand mixer or hand mixer, beat eggs, egg yolk, sugar, oil, and vanilla extract on medium-high speed until frothy and pale. This step helps create that shiny top.
Step 4: Melt the Chocolate
In a small saucepan over medium heat, melt butter and chocolate chips together until smooth. Remove from heat and immediately stir in cocoa powder and espresso powder.
Then, pour the warm chocolate mixture directly into the wet ingredients. Mix until just combined.
Step 5: Combine Everything
Add the dry ingredients and mix on low speed until just combined. Avoid overmixing. The batter will look slightly thin but still scoopable.
Step 6: Scoop and Bake
Using a 1 1/2 tablespoon cookie scoop, portion the batter onto prepared baking sheets. Leave about 1 1/2 inches between cookies.
Sprinkle sea salt flakes on top.
Bake for 8-10 minutes. The tops should look shiny and crackled. For extra chocolate, press 3-4 additional chocolate chips into each cookie immediately after removing them from the oven.
Let cookies c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a cooling rack.

Pro Tips for Perfect Salted Brownie Cookies
Work Quickly
Because this batter creates its shine from the egg-sugar mixture, letting it sit too long reduces that crackly finish. Therefore, scoop and bake immediately after mixing.
Use a Cookie Scoop
A cookie scoop keeps sizes uniform and ensures even baking. Consistent sizing also gives you evenly crackled tops.
Shape for Perfect Circles
Right after baking, place a round cookie cutter slightly larger than the cookie around it. Gently swirl in a circular motion for 5-8 seconds. This reshapes the cookie into a perfect round while it's still soft.
Use an oven mitt to hold the hot baking sheet while shaping.
Storage and Make-Ahead Tips
Salted Brownie Cookies taste best within two days. Store them in a sealed container at room temperature.
Because the batter performs best when baked immediately, avoid refrigerating or freezing raw dough. Instead, bake all cookies and freeze them after cooling. To freeze, store in an airtight container for up to two months.
When ready to enjoy, let them thaw at room temperature for about 30 minutes.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Why did my cookies turn out thin?
This batter spreads naturally. However, ensure accurate flour measurement and bake immediately after mixing.
2. Why didn't I get shiny crackly tops?
The batter likely sat too long before baking. Work quickly to preserve that glossy finish.
3. Can I use a different oil?
Yes. Use a neutral oil like avocado or canola for best results.
4. Can I skip espresso powder?
Absolutely. It enhances chocolate flavor but remains optional.
5. How do I keep them soft?
Store in an airtight container and avoid overbaking. Slightly underbaked centers ensure fudginess.
